From here we headed west and discovered fhe Vore Buffalo Jump near Beulah WY. This site (a sink hole) was unearthed in the 70's by the highway department when they were putting in the interstate. There is now an interpretive centre and an archeological site where the remains of buffalo which stampeded into the sink hole were butchered by indians are being progressively unearthed.
